candidate
This commit is contained in:
commit
419d24d407
13 changed files with 1019 additions and 10 deletions
61
stages/migrations/0003_ame=Add_Candidate_model.py
Normal file
61
stages/migrations/0003_ame=Add_Candidate_model.py
Normal file
|
|
@ -0,0 +1,61 @@
|
|||
# -*- coding: utf-8 -*-
|
||||
# Generated by Django 1.11.2 on 2017-09-05 16:56
|
||||
from __future__ import unicode_literals
|
||||
|
||||
from django.db import migrations, models
|
||||
import django.db.models.deletion
|
||||
import django.utils.timezone
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('stages', '0002_add_student_option_ase'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.CreateModel(
|
||||
name='Candidate',
|
||||
fields=[
|
||||
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
||||
('first_name', models.CharField(max_length=40, verbose_name='Prénom')),
|
||||
('last_name', models.CharField(max_length=40, verbose_name='Nom')),
|
||||
('gender', models.CharField(choices=[('M', 'Masculin'), ('F', 'Féminin'), ('I', 'Inconnu')], max_length=3, verbose_name='Genre')),
|
||||
('birth_date', models.DateField(blank=True, verbose_name='Date de naissance')),
|
||||
('street', models.CharField(blank=True, max_length=150, verbose_name='Rue')),
|
||||
('pcode', models.CharField(max_length=4, verbose_name='Code postal')),
|
||||
('city', models.CharField(max_length=40, verbose_name='Localité')),
|
||||
('tel', models.CharField(blank=True, max_length=40, verbose_name='Téléphone')),
|
||||
('mobile', models.CharField(blank=True, max_length=40, verbose_name='Portable')),
|
||||
('email', models.EmailField(blank=True, max_length=254, verbose_name='Courriel')),
|
||||
('avs', models.CharField(blank=True, max_length=15, verbose_name='No AVS')),
|
||||
('handicap', models.BooleanField(default=False)),
|
||||
('exemption_ecg', models.BooleanField(default=False)),
|
||||
('date_confirmation_mail', models.DateField(auto_now_add=True, verbose_name='Mail de confirmation')),
|
||||
],
|
||||
),
|
||||
migrations.CreateModel(
|
||||
name='District',
|
||||
fields=[
|
||||
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
||||
('abrev', models.CharField(max_length=10)),
|
||||
('name', models.CharField(max_length=30)),
|
||||
],
|
||||
),
|
||||
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='district',
|
||||
field=models.ForeignKey(default=None, null=True, on_delete=django.db.models.deletion.CASCADE, to='stages.District'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='option',
|
||||
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.SET_NULL, to='stages.Option'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='section',
|
||||
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='stages.Section'),
|
||||
),
|
||||
]
|
||||
16
stages/migrations/0004_ame=Add_EdsCandidate_model.py
Normal file
16
stages/migrations/0004_ame=Add_EdsCandidate_model.py
Normal file
|
|
@ -0,0 +1,16 @@
|
|||
# -*- coding: utf-8 -*-
|
||||
# Generated by Django 1.11.2 on 2017-09-05 17:06
|
||||
from __future__ import unicode_literals
|
||||
|
||||
from django.db import migrations, models
|
||||
import django.db.models.deletion
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('stages', '0003_ame=Add_Candidate_model'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
]
|
||||
169
stages/migrations/0005_ame=Ame_Candidate.py
Normal file
169
stages/migrations/0005_ame=Ame_Candidate.py
Normal file
|
|
@ -0,0 +1,169 @@
|
|||
# -*- coding: utf-8 -*-
|
||||
# Generated by Django 1.11.2 on 2017-09-07 14:40
|
||||
from __future__ import unicode_literals
|
||||
|
||||
from django.db import migrations, models
|
||||
import django.db.models.deletion
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('stages', '0004_ame=Add_EdsCandidate_model'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.CreateModel(
|
||||
name='Config',
|
||||
fields=[
|
||||
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
|
||||
('key', models.CharField(max_length=100)),
|
||||
('value', models.TextField()),
|
||||
('comment', models.TextField()),
|
||||
],
|
||||
),
|
||||
migrations.RemoveField(
|
||||
model_name='candidate',
|
||||
name='tel',
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='certif_of_800h',
|
||||
field=models.BooleanField(default=False, verbose_name='Attest. 800h.'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='certif_of_cfc',
|
||||
field=models.BooleanField(default=False, verbose_name='CFC'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='certificate_of_payement',
|
||||
field=models.BooleanField(default=False, verbose_name='Attest. paiement'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='comment',
|
||||
field=models.TextField(blank=True, default='', verbose_name='Remarques'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='contract',
|
||||
field=models.BooleanField(default=False, verbose_name='Contrat valide'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='corporation',
|
||||
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.SET_NULL, to='stages.Corporation', verbose_name='Employeur'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='cv',
|
||||
field=models.BooleanField(default=False, verbose_name='CV'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='deposite_date',
|
||||
field=models.DateField(blank=True, default=None, null=True, verbose_name='Date dépôt dossier'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='examination_result',
|
||||
field=models.PositiveSmallIntegerField(blank=True, default=0, verbose_name='Points examen'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='file_result',
|
||||
field=models.PositiveSmallIntegerField(blank=True, default=0, verbose_name='Points dossier'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='instructor',
|
||||
field=models.ForeignKey(blank=True, null=True, on_delete=django.db.models.deletion.SET_NULL, to='stages.CorpContact', verbose_name='FEE/FPP'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='interview_date',
|
||||
field=models.DateTimeField(blank=True, default=None, null=True, verbose_name='Date entretien prof.'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='interview_result',
|
||||
field=models.PositiveSmallIntegerField(blank=True, default=0, verbose_name='Points entretien prof.'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='interview_room',
|
||||
field=models.CharField(blank=True, max_length=50, verbose_name="Salle d'entretien prof."),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='marks_certificate',
|
||||
field=models.BooleanField(default=False, verbose_name='Bull. notes'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='police_record',
|
||||
field=models.BooleanField(default=False, verbose_name='Casier judic.'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='proc_admin_ext',
|
||||
field=models.BooleanField(default=False, verbose_name='Insc. autre école'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='promise',
|
||||
field=models.BooleanField(default=False, verbose_name="Promesse d'eng."),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='reflexive_text',
|
||||
field=models.BooleanField(default=False, verbose_name='Texte réflexif'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='registration_form',
|
||||
field=models.BooleanField(default=False, verbose_name="Formulaire d'inscription"),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='total_result_mark',
|
||||
field=models.PositiveSmallIntegerField(blank=True, default=0, verbose_name='Note finale'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='total_result_points',
|
||||
field=models.PositiveSmallIntegerField(blank=True, default=0, verbose_name='Total points'),
|
||||
),
|
||||
migrations.AddField(
|
||||
model_name='candidate',
|
||||
name='work_certificate',
|
||||
field=models.BooleanField(default=False, verbose_name='Certif. de travail'),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name='candidate',
|
||||
name='birth_date',
|
||||
field=models.DateField(blank=True, default=None, null=True, verbose_name='Date de naissance'),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name='candidate',
|
||||
name='date_confirmation_mail',
|
||||
field=models.DateField(blank=True, default=None, null=True, verbose_name='Mail de confirmation'),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name='candidate',
|
||||
name='district',
|
||||
field=models.ForeignKey(default=None, null=True, on_delete=django.db.models.deletion.CASCADE, to='stages.District', verbose_name='Canton'),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name='candidate',
|
||||
name='option',
|
||||
field=models.CharField(blank=True, max_length=20, null=True),
|
||||
),
|
||||
migrations.AlterField(
|
||||
model_name='candidate',
|
||||
name='section',
|
||||
field=models.CharField(choices=[('ASA', 'Aide en soin et accompagnement AFP'), ('ASE', 'Assist. socio-éducatif-ve CFC'), ('ASSC', 'Assist. en soin et santé communautaire CFC'), ('EDE', "Educ. de l'enfance, dipl. ES"), ('EDS', 'Educ. social-e, dipl. ES')], max_length=10, verbose_name='Filière'),
|
||||
),
|
||||
]
|
||||
Loading…
Add table
Add a link
Reference in a new issue